sqltuning就是数据库调优,即通过一些技术来优化你的数据库的性能;通常这些技术包括但不仅限于:
1.sql代码优化;
2.数据库结构优化;
3.时间优化,空间优化;等等等等,通过优化以后,你的数据库跑起来会很快,或者会很稳定,或者又快又稳定.优化,没有绝对,只有相对.可参考前辈的经验,又不能死背经验.
casewhen0then‘是’when1then‘否’;一般情况下在查询语句中用,根居不同的数据结果查询转换成自己想要的类型;楼主的情况,建议用存储过程,写if语法来做处理
要提高SQL编写能力,可以采取以下几种方法:
1. 不断学习SQL语法:了解SQL的语法规则和常用函数,熟悉SQL的语法可以提高编写SQL的效率和准确性。
2. 阅读高质量的SQL代码:阅读别人写的高质量的SQL代码可以帮助学习优秀的编码风格和技巧,有助于提高SQL编写能力。
3. 多实践:通过不断实践编写SQL语句,对不同的业务需求进行SQL实现,加深对SQL的理解,同时也积累编写SQL的经验。
4. 利用工具和资源:使用SQL编写工具,如SQL编辑器、数据库管理工具等,这些工具可以提供语法提示、自动补全等功能,提高编写SQL的效率。此外,还可以利用互联网上的SQL学习资源,如SQL教程、博客、论坛等,了解最新的SQL技术和实践。
5. 优化和调试SQL语句:学会分析、优化和调试SQL语句,提高SQL的性能和效率,减少数据库的负载。
6. 参与开源项目和社区:参与开源项目和社区可以接触到更多的SQL编码实践和经验,与其他开发者交流、学习,提高SQL编写能力。
总之,提高SQL编写能力需要坚持学习、多实践、积累经验,并利用工具和资源进行辅助,不断提高自己的SQL技能。
1、sqlserver2008r2这个版本好,比较稳定
2、需要安装sqlserver2008r2,可以下载这个:
microsoftsqlserver2008r2开发版/企业版/标准版(简体中文)
SQL Server是一款由微软开发的关系型数据库管理系统(RDBMS)。每个版本都有其自身的优点,选择适合自己需求的版本取决于具体情况。
以下是SQL Server的几个主要版本:
1. SQL Server 2019:最新版本,具有很多新功能和性能改进,支持更高级的安全性和大规模数据分析。
2. SQL Server 2017:具有跨平台支持、更快速的查询性能和更好的数据安全性,还增加了更多的数据分析工具。
3. SQL Server 2016:引入了许多新功能,如实时操作分析、行级安全性和动态数据脱敏。
4. SQL Server 2014:带来了一些重要的性能改进和安全增强,同时引入了内存优化表功能。
5. SQL Server 2012:增强了报表功能、列存储索引和可扩展性。
选择最适合的版本需要考虑你的需求、预算和系统要求。如果你需要最新功能和性能改进,那么选择最新版本(如SQL Server 2019)可能是个不错的选择。如果你对特定功能有需求,可以进一步研究各个版本的特点和功能来做出决策。
到此,以上就是小编对于SQL优化器之rewrite的问题就介绍到这了,希望介绍的4点解答对大家有用,有任何问题和不懂的,欢迎各位老师在评论区讨论,给我留言。
sqlserver如何导入excel数据如何能把excel大量数据快...
Ubuntu系统下可以做什么1+xweb中级考核内容包括什么Ub...
五张表关联查询语句SQL怎么写从多个表中查询数据的sql语句SQL一...
数学问题复合函数有没有同奇异偶这个性质奇异函数平衡原理奇异函数平衡法...
周期函数excel剩余周数函数公式excel月份星期函数公式周期函数...
用第三个表达式替换第一个字符串表达式中出现的所有第二个给定字符串表达式。
语法
REPLACE ( ''string_replace1'' , ''string_replace2'' , ''string_replace3'' )
参数
''string_replace1''
待搜索的字符串表达式。string_replace1 可以是字符数据或二进制数据。
''string_replace2''
待查找的字符串表达式。string_replace2 可以是字符数据或二进制数据。
在SQL Server中,REPLACE函数用于替换字符串中出现的指定子字符串。它接受三个参数:原字符串,要被替换的子字符串和替换后的子字符串。
该函数会查找原字符串中的所有匹配项,并将其替换为指定的字符串。如果原字符串中不存在要替换的子字符串,则不会发生任何更改。使用REPLACE函数可以轻松地进行字符串替换操作,例如将某些特定字符替换为其他字符或将一部分文本替换为其他文本。这在数据清洗和字符串处理中非常有用。
12。replace('string" class="zf_thumb" width="48" height="48" title="SqlServer中REPLACE函数的使用,sql替换字符串函数" />